Smoked Paprika and Lime Aioli for Potatoes
Creamy, tangy, and smoky aioli that perks up any potato dish with just a squeeze of lime and a whisper of paprika.

Ingredients
Servings:
- 1 cup mayonnaise
- 1 teaspoon smoked paprika
- 1 tablespoon fresh lime juice
- 1 clove garlic, minced
- 1 teaspoon honey
- Salt to taste
Steps
- 1 In a medium bowl, combine mayonnaise, smoked paprika, lime juice, minced garlic, and honey.
- 2 Whisk until smooth and well combined.
- 3 Season with salt to taste.
- 4 Cover and let flavors meld in the fridge for at least 30 minutes before serving.

Substitutions
- If you don't have smoked paprika, regular paprika can be used but will result in a milder flavor.

Storage
Store in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 5 days. Bring to room temperature before serving for best flavor.
Freezing: Does not freeze well due to potential texture changes.
